Output 3e9952e5d91d608068df55f62927c293b78f0b0a90dec0547a9e8fa00e05a848:1

value
2205966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ed71b8c04aaa8eba505091adc5eabe82f65be1e OP_EQUAL
address
3HdVBrsafxwr3bfKLsCfZv7nYGq9pN6Vnx
transaction
3e9952e5d91d608068df55f62927c293b78f0b0a90dec0547a9e8fa00e05a848
confirmations
251705
spent
true